McCallion John D. (CIK 0001709116)

Latest company ownership

Shares held
245,129
Last filed at
Mar 5, 2025
Confidence Score
50.2
2025Q4
Confidence Score History
2025Q1 2025Q4
Role: CFO
Shares held
204,781
Last filed at
Mar 5, 2024
Confidence Score
50.0
2025Q4
Confidence Score History
2020Q1 2025Q4

Recent buy/sell transactions

Exec date Filing date Company Role Signal Confidence Shares % of shares Under plan? Amount (USD)
Mar 3, 2025 Mar 5, 2025 METLIFE INC CFO Sell 20.0 -5,232 -2.09% $448.4K
Feb 25, 2025 Feb 27, 2025 METLIFE INC CFO Sell 100.0 +45,580 22.26% $2.2M
Mar 1, 2024 Mar 5, 2024 METLIFE INC CFO Sell 20.0 -5,164 -2.46% $360.1K
Feb 27, 2024 Feb 29, 2024 METLIFE INC CFO Sell 100.0 +48,147 29.76% $2.4M
Feb 28, 2023 Mar 2, 2023 METLIFE INC CFO Sell 100.0 +45,187 43.13% $3.4M
Mar 1, 2022 Mar 3, 2022 METLIFE INC CFO Sell 20.0 -5,437 -4.93% $350.4K
Feb 22, 2022 Feb 24, 2022 METLIFE INC CFO Sell 100.0 +44,434 67.56% $2.2M
Mar 1, 2021 Mar 3, 2021 METLIFE INC CFO Sell 22.5 -3,663 -5.28% $217.4K
Feb 24, 2021 Feb 26, 2021 METLIFE INC CFO Sell 20.0 -7,742 -10.03% $460.8K
Feb 23, 2021 Feb 25, 2021 METLIFE INC CFO Sell 95.0 +15,651 30.82% $155.7K
Feb 5, 2021 Feb 8, 2021 METLIFE INC CFO Sell 20.0 -7,456 -19.13% $389.3K
Mar 2, 2020 Mar 4, 2020 METLIFE INC CFO Sell 42.5 -1,808 -2.06% $80.6K
Feb 25, 2020 Feb 27, 2020 METLIFE INC CFO Sell 95.0 +2,626 10.82% $64.5K